"Great location! It's 10 min walk from Houshanpi MRT station and 5 min walk from Songshan Train station (good if you travel out of Taipei City for day trips). Wufenpu Night market is just round the corner (2mins walk) but personally I do not find their price super cheap. Some shops only sell wholesale and will not entertain you if you want to buy just one piece. Staff from the hotel are friendly and helpful if you need information. One point to note is that the hotel does not allow late checkouts (if your flight is in the evening). But you can still leave your luggage with them and retrieve them when you are ready to depart for airport. If you want to take a cab to the hotel from the airport, it costs around NTD 1300. I understand that the hotel can arrange for one at NTD 1000, so do check with them. There is another branch at Ximending area (which is more convenient and central), though I'm not too sure if the price is the same as this one in Songshan. "
